Midnight Lute closed strongly from off the pace and won the $2 million Breeders’ Cup Sprint by 4 3/4 lengths Saturday, sending trainer Bob Baffert to the winner’s circle at Monmouth Park for the second time. Baffert opened the eight-race Breeders’ Cup card by winning the $2 million Juvenile Fillies with Indian Blessing.

War Pass, ridden by Cornelio Velazquez, leads the Breeders Cup Juvenile horse race at Monmouth Park on Saturday, Oct. 27, 2007 in Oceanport, NJ. War Pass won the race.

Nick Zito, go ahead and book a reservation for the first Saturday in May. Undefeated War Pass gave the Hall of Fame trainer an entry into next year’s Kentucky Derby with a 4 1/2 -length victory in Saturday’s $2 million Breeders’ Cup Juvenile. The colt led all the way, beating Pyro by 4 1/2 lengths, for Zito’s first victory in racing’s richest event since 1996.
